Alex Hoffs is President of PSM, appointed in 2010, and Head of the Gas Turbine Service Group for Hanwha H2 Energy, leading the global service business. He has 25+ years of gas turbine experience and held various leadership roles in new units and service, both in Europe and the United States.
Alex sits on the Industrial Advisory Boards of ASME and the UCF College of Engineering. He actively supports the Autism Project of Palm Beach County, and lives with his family in Jupiter, Florida. Alex holds an advanced engineering degree from RWTH Aachen in Germany and obtained his Ph.D. from EPF Lausanne in Switzerland. He is a graduate of Alstom’s INSEAD Executive Leadership Program.
